Abstract | Three decades ago, members of the roofing community met at the National Research Council of Canada and formed a group with a common focus on evaluating roofing systems in a dynamic environment. As a result, the Special Interest Group on Dynamic Evaluation of Roofing Systems (SIGDERS) was created. SIGDERS’ operation is one of its kind in the world, with the legacy of a long-lasting research and development consortia. In this session, the impacts of SIGDERS on the industry will be discussed, including advancements in the areas of static vs. dynamic roof evaluations, diagnoses of the weakest link, significance of the roof edge, and field vs. code specification. |
